voltio Posted December 18, 2007 Posted December 18, 2007 I know I'm in the minority here, but I think that this set is quite good. It has the same colors and construction techniques as the 7261 CTT, so the AT-AP will look sharp displayed next to it in Clone Wars dioramas. The UK pricing is :-X , so I can see why the original reviewer is displeased, but the USA price of $40 seems fair. The only thing I can complain about are the shock troopers (we have enough from the battle packs) and the exposed gunner turret, which can be easily MOCed away by removing the seat and making it unmanned.
